All the below are slogans or “taglines” used to promote films. Name them. All are listed in chronological order, from 1930 to 1976 – I’ve indicated which decades they are from. 1930s.
1. "Garbo TALKS!" Anna Christie
2. "The story of the strangest passion the world has ever known!" Dracula
3. "The Monster demands a Mate!" Bride of Frankenstein
4. "They're Dancing Cheek-to-Cheek Again!" Top Hat
5. "The greatest screen entertainment of all time!" Gone With the Wind
1940s.
6. "Walt Disney's Technicolor FEATURE triumph" Fantasia
7. "For anyone who has ever wished upon a star." Pinocchio
8. "EVERYBODY'S TALKING ABOUT IT! It's Terrific!" Citizen Kane
9. "A story as EXPLOSIVE as his BLAZING automatics!" The Maltese Falcon
10. "Humphrey Bogart...with his kind of woman in a powerful adaptation of Ernest Hemingway's most daring man-woman story!" To Have and to Have Not
11. "They're making memories tonight!" It's a Wonderful Life
12. "Pick up the pieces folks, Jimmy's in action again!" White Heat
1950s.
13. "The greatest adventure a man ever lived...with a woman!" The African Queen
14. "The dramatic lives of trapeze artists, a clown, and an elephant trainer against a background of circus spectacle." the Greatest Show on Earth
15. "The story of a man who was too proud to run." High Noon
16. "MGM's Technicolor Musical Treasure!" Singin' in the Rain
17. "The boldest book of our time... Honestly, fearlessly on the screen!" From Here To Eternity
18. "Blood red kisses! White hot thrills! Mickey Spillane's latest H-bomb!" Kiss me Deadly
19 "Jim Stark - a kid from a 'good' family - what makes him tick...like a bomb?" Rebel Without a Cause
20."he had to find her...he had to find her." The Searchers
21. "It spans a whole new world of entertainment!" Bridge Over the River Kwai
22. "Alfred Hitchcock engulfs you in a whirlpool of terror and tension!" Vertigo
23."It's a deadly game of 'tag' and Cary Grant is 'it'!" AND "It's love and murder at first sight!" North By Northwest
24."Unspeakable Horrors From Outer Space Paralyze the Living and Resurrect The Dead!" Plan 9 From Outer Space
25. "The movie too HOT for words!" Some Like it Hot
1960s
26 "Check in. Relax. Take a shower." Psycho
27. "Together For The First Time - James Stewart - John Wayne - in the masterpiece of four-time Academy Award winner John Ford" The Man Who Shot Liberty Valance
28. "Sister, sister, oh so fair, why is there blood all over your hair?" What Ever Happened to Baby Jane?
29 "...and remember, the next scream you hear may be your own!" Birds
30. "What does he become? What kind of monster?" The Nutty Professor
31. "James Bond is back in action! Everything he touches turns to excitement!" Goldfinger
32. "The loverliest motion picture of them all!" My Fair Lady
33. "A Love Caught in the Fire of Revolution" Dr Zhivago
34. "For Three Men The Civil War Wasn't Hell. It Was Practice!" The Good, The Bad and The Ugly
35. "You are cordially invited to George and Martha's for an evening of fun and games." Who's Afraid of Virginia Woolf
36. "They're young...they're in love...and they kill people." Bonnie and Clyde
37. "This is Benjamin. He's a little worried about his future." The Graduate
38. "An epic drama of adventure and exploration." 2001: A Space Odessey
39. "Nine men who came too late and stayed too long..." The Wild Bunch
1970s
40. "Being the adventures of a young man whose principal interests are rape, ultra-violence and Beethoven." A Clockwork Orange
41. "You don't assign him to murder cases. You just turn him loose." Dirty Harry
42. "A $32,000,000 chase turns into the American thriller of the year!" The French Connection
43. “This is the weekend they didn't play golf." Deliverance
44. "...all it takes is a little Confidence." The Sting
45. "See it before you go swimming." Jaws
46. "His whole life was a million-to-one shot." Rocky
47. "On every street in every city, there's a nobody who dreams of being a somebody." Taxi Driver
